What Is Patterned Conveyor Belt
Patterned conveyor belt is a type of conveyor belt with specially designed surface patterns to prevent material slipping during conveying.
It is widely used in inclined conveying systems, where standard flat belts cannot provide sufficient grip for materials.

Pattern Types Available
Different pattern designs are available to suit various conveying angles, material types and working conditions:
- Dot pattern – suitable for light materials and gentle inclines, providing basic anti-slip performance and smooth conveying
- V pattern – commonly used for general inclined conveying, offering stable grip and consistent material flow
- Cross pattern – improves stability for mixed or irregular materials, reducing shifting and enhancing conveying control
- Chevron pattern (Continuous) – ideal for steeper conveying angles, providing strong grip to effectively prevent material slipping
- Open chevron pattern (Separated) – suitable for conditions where material build-up needs to be minimized, while maintaining reliable anti-slip performance
- Multi-V chevron pattern (Convex type) – features multiple rows of V-shaped cleats, providing enhanced grip and stability for demanding and high-angle conveying
- Crescent pattern – suitable for specific bulk handling conditions, especially for materials requiring controlled and stable movement
- Multi-crescent pattern (Dense type) – densely arranged arc-shaped patterns offer uniform contact, ideal for light to medium materials requiring smooth and stable conveying
Different pattern types can be selected based on material characteristics, conveying angle and working environment to ensure optimal conveying performance and efficiency.

How to Select the Right Conveyor Belt Pattern
Choosing the correct pattern type is essential to ensure stable conveying performance and prevent material slipping. The selection mainly depends on the following three factors:
Conveying Angle
The steeper the incline, the stronger grip is required:
- 0–10° → Flat belt or dot pattern
- 10–20° → V pattern / cross pattern
- 20–30° → Chevron pattern (continuous)
- Above 30° → Multi-V chevron pattern or customized high-profile patterns
Material Characteristics
Different materials require different surface designs:
- Light & fine materials (grain, powder) → dot pattern / crescent pattern
- Mixed or irregular materials → cross pattern
- High-density or heavy materials (coal, ore) → chevron or multi-V pattern
- Sticky or wet materials → open chevron pattern (reduced build-up)
Working Conditions
Consider the actual operating environment:
- High drop height / impact loading → chevron or multi-V pattern
- Need smooth conveying & stability → crescent or multi-crescent pattern
- Need to reduce material accumulation → open chevron pattern
- Long-distance conveying systems → V pattern or chevron pattern

Applications of Patterned Conveyor Belt
Patterned conveyor belts are widely used for inclined conveying of bulk materials where slipping may occur.
Typical applications include:
- Grain handling
- Coal conveying
- Cement industry
- Sand and aggregates
- Bulk material handling systems
They are suitable for conveying small to medium-sized particles as well as loose bulk materials.
Advantages for Inclined Conveying
The patterned surface provides additional grip, allowing materials to be transported at higher angles compared to flat conveyor belts.
This reduces material spillage, improves conveying efficiency, and ensures more stable operation in inclined systems.
